Turkish Government Takes Precautions Amid Escalating Regional Conflict

The Turkish government has issued a statement warning against provocations in the region as tensions between Turkey, Iran, the United States, and Israel continue to rise.

According to President Recep Tayyip Erdogan, Ankara is closely monitoring the situation and taking necessary measures to protect its airspace. The exact nature of these measures is not specified, but officials have confirmed that the government is exercising caution in light of the escalating conflict.

The regional war involves multiple countries, including Iran, the US, and Israel, which has raised concerns among regional leaders about potential instability. Turkish authorities are working closely with their international partners to address the situation and prevent any further escalation.

In a statement, Erdogan emphasized the importance of maintaining stability in the region and avoiding actions that could lead to conflict. The Turkish government is urging all parties involved to exercise restraint and work towards a peaceful resolution.
